Analysis

The most recent figure for medium/high density fibreboard (mdf/hdf) β€” export value in Syrian Arab Republic is 5 1000 USD, measured in 2024.

That represents a change of down 95.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, medium/high density fibreboard (mdf/hdf) β€” export value in Syrian Arab Republic peaked at 707 1000 USD in 2009 and was at its lowest, 0 1000 USD, in 2020.

Syrian Arab Republic ranks 123rd of 147 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
